Hoe Bridge School is seeking a passionate and dedicated Deputy Nursery Manager to support the leadership and day-to-day running of their nurturing and high-quality Greenfield Little School Early Years setting. As Deputy Nursery Manager, you will work closely with the Nursery Manager to ensure the smooth operation of the setting while maintaining the highest standards in line with the EYFS Statutory Framework and Ofsted requirements. You will play a key leadership role, supporting staff, engaging with families, and stepping up to lead the nursery in the manager's absence. This is a hands-on position, requiring flexibility and a willingness to support across all areas, including working directly with children in the classrooms, while contributing to continuous improvement, staff development, safeguarding practices, and the overall quality of care and education provided. This is an exciting opportunity for someone who thrives in a dynamic environment and is committed to delivering outstanding care and education.

Key Responsibilities

  • Operational Leadership: Support the daily running of the nursery, including staff rotas, health & safety checks, and maintaining accurate records.
  • Child Development & Learning: Deliver and support high-quality care and education, ensuring an engaging and effective EYFS curriculum for all children.
  • Team Leadership & Support: Mentor and supervise Room Leaders and Practitioners, contributing to inductions, supervisions, and appraisals.
  • Safeguarding & Welfare: Act as Deputy Designated Safeguarding Lead, promoting a safe, secure, and inclusive environment for children, staff, and visitors.
  • Parent Partnerships: Build strong relationships with families, communicate children's progress, and support enquiries and nursery tours.
  • Compliance & Standards: Ensure the nursery consistently meets all statutory requirements and maintains excellent Ofsted standards.

Greenfield Little School is a well-established, nurturing early years setting providing high-quality care and education for children aged 6 months to 4+ years. Operating year-round, Little School supports each child's development and prepares them for a smooth transition into Reception in the September prior to their fifth birthday. As an integral part of Hoe Bridge School, it reflects the same ethos, combining a warm, welcoming atmosphere with a strong focus on purposeful learning and development.
